🎨 AJHS Color Wheel Fun! 🌈
Students in the RISE art class dove into the world of color through hands-on, sensory-friendly activities! After mastering primary colors and creating their own tints and shades, they got creative mixing secondary and tertiary colors using straws, squeegees, and droppers. Each student even built and labeled their own color wheel to bring their learning to life! 🎨👏 #D102 #EveryDayEveryStudent

⭐ New Board Members Sworn In! ⭐
At the May 12 D102 Board of Education meeting, we welcomed new Board members Laurie Kuriakose and Anthony Q. Lee, along with re-elected members Jordan Sklansky and Pelleg Graupe. The Honorable Marnie Slavin — a proud D102 alum — officiated the swearing-in.
We were also honored to have State Representative Daniel Didech in attendance to thank outgoing Board members Deepa Ajmire and Vera Gaskill for their dedicated service.
Following the ceremony, the Board selected its officers:
⭐ Jordan Sklansky – Board President
⭐ Pelleg Graupe – Board Vice President
⭐ Melissa Rose – Board Secretary
It was a night of celebration, gratitude, and a strong commitment to the future of D102 students!


🎉 The Meridian Ambassadors have been hard at work on a special project — "Celebrating Meridian School" — an exhibit opening soon at the Raupp Museum in Buffalo Grove!
This unique showcase highlights the legacy of D102 and Meridian School since opening its doors in 1994. It honors beloved staff members, past and present, including:
🍎 Lindsay Zucker, Priscilla Podeschi & AJ Teplinsky — former Meridian students who are now teachers at the school!
🎓 Cheri Brill, Sherrie Cummins & Stacy Lipshutz — the final three original staff members retiring after helping open the school 30 years ago.
You'll also find historic items on display like the original blueprint, groundbreaking shovel, and more!
